Meet the series 7 Sewing Bees!
The Great British Sewing Bee makes a welcome return to our screens on April 14th, showcasing the best and brightest amateur sewists. Series 7 sees judges Patrick Grant and Esme Young lead 10 more weeks of exciting sewing challenges, with presenter Joe Lycett here to keep spirits up in the work room.
